Substituent effects on solvent-free epoxidation catalyzed by dioxomolybdenum(VI) complexes supported by ONO Schiff base ligands
چکیده انگلیسی


• Synthesis and characterization of substituted tridentate Schiff-base dioxomolybdenum complexes.
• These [MoO2L]2 complexes are active epoxidation catalysts.
• Analysis of the molecular structures.
• Electronic effect of donor and acceptor substituents on the catalytic activity.

Molybdenum complexes of type [MoO2L]n (L = tridentate ONO Schiff base ligands based on the salicylidene-2-aminophenolato structure) have been synthesized and used as catalysts for the solvent-free epoxidation of olefins. The effect of donor (diethylamino) and/or acceptor (nitro) substituents has been studied.

The effect of tridentate Schiff base donor and acceptor substituents on the catalytic activity of molybdenum complexes in solvent-free cyclooctene epoxidation has been observed experimentally and rationalized through DFT calculations.Figure optionsDownload as PowerPoint slide
